OPP NEWS RELEASES

********************* Largest marijuana seizure in Iroquois Falls area ever

One of the biggest in Ontario in recent memory

(Iroquois Falls, On) - On July 24th, 2005 Project "Northern Gateway" (a joint investigation between members of the Ontario Provincial Police OPP Drug Enforcement, North East Region OPP and North Bay Police service), assisted by members of the, Emergency Response Unit, Ract, K-9 and the Iroquois Falls OPP executed a Controlled Drugs and Substance Act Search Warrant at 1282 Frank Road in Clergue Township.

That resulted in the seizure of a large quantity of marijuana in the fields [shown] behind the residence.

One male was arrested at the scene and held pending a bail hearing in Timmins Court scheduled for Monday the 25th of July.

In excess of twenty-one thousand plants were seized.

The plants were in various stages of growth, ranging in size from 8-24 inches but were estimated at a value in excess of twenty-one million dollars upon maturity.

Also seized was offence related property (tractor, furrow, pump, hoses, hand implements) with an estimated value of $35,000.

Charged: CHU, Zhi, Ji D.O.B: 24 Dec 1965 0f Scarborough, Ontario

He has been charged with Production of a Controlled Substance to wit Cannabis Marijuana Contrary to Section 7(1) of the Controlled Drugs and Substances Act.

******************* Large marijuana seizure Joly Township residence

(Sundridge, On) - On July 19th, 2005 Project "Northern Gateway" (a joint investigation between members of the Ontario Provincial Police OPP Drug Enforcement, North East Region OPP and North Bay Police service), assisted by members of the Almaguin Highlands OPP Crime Unit, Emergency Response Unit and the Almaguin Highlands OPP executed a Controlled Drugs and Substance Act Search Warrant at 1335 Forrest Lake Road Joly Township.

That resulted in the seizure of a large quantity of marijuana in the fields behind the residence as well as drugs and offence related property from the residence.

Four males were arrested at the scene and held pending a bail hearing in Parry Sound Court scheduled for Wednesday the 20th of July.

In excess of seven thousand plants were seized.

The plants were in various stages of growth and were estimated at a value in excess of seven million dollars upon maturity.

A small amount of dried marijuana and ecstasy was also seized.

Also seized was offence related property (pumps, heaters, light hoods, timers light bulbs) with an estimated value of $2000.

Charged: YE, Kai, Xuan D.O.B: 09 Dec 1976 0f Markham, Ontario

CHEN, MIng, Xiang D.O.B: 08 Feb 1979 Of Scarborough, Ontario

LIU, Ping Jian D.O.B: 10Jun1968 Of Scarborough

ZHU, Zhen, Yu D.O.B: 20Nov1975 Of Toronto

All are charged with production of a controlled substance to wit cannabis marijuana contrary to Section 7(1) of the Controlled Drugs and Substances Act, two counts of possession of a controlled substance in relation to the dried marijuana and ecstasy 4(1) CDSA and one count of possession of a controlled substance to wit marijuana for the purpose of trafficking 5(2) CDSA
